ThemePath and Firefox Images
I am using a custom theme for my application and ran into an obscure problem where the theme's images weren't showing up in Firefox, while they rendered fine in IE and Chrome. For example, the combobox trigger was not rendering in Firefox.
Firefox could not find the images that were relative to the CSS file (even though it was able to locate the CSS file). It turns out the issue was that I used backward slashes in my themePath setting instead of forward slashes. I define my theme path in the web.config file -- before it was like this:

<extnet themePath="themes\mytheme\mytheme-all.css">
It needs to be like this:<extnet themePath="themes/mytheme/mytheme-all.css">
Changing it to use forward slashes fixed this issue for me.
